So I've been playing Brawl for a while with a 360 controller (running at 55-60 fps) and so I never felt I needed a WiiMote. It was until I started playing Wii Sports with my friends that I realized how awesome it would be to play without having to use a 360 controller. Therefore, I need suggestions and advice on what to buy.

Controller/WiiMote:
I'm most likely going to get the Nintendo ones ($20) but what are your opinions on 3rd party ones.

Sensor Bar:
Any of these I'm assuming will work http://www.amazon.com/s/ref=nb_sb_ss_i_0_10?url=search-alias%3Daps&field-keywords=wii+sensor+bar&sprefix=wii+sensor%2Caps%2C229

But the main thing I'm worried about is the bluetooth dongle since that's what connects the WiiMotes. I'll definitely have two controllers connected all the time and occassional 3-4 so would the cheaper (less than $5) be bad options or should I just get something like this: which has a lot of positive ratings http://www.amazon.com/Medialink-USB-Bluetooth-Adapter-Technology/dp/B004LNXO28/ref=sr_1_2?ie=UTF8&qid=1353788756&sr=8-2&keywords=usb+bluetooth+dongle


Suggestions and links to pages of accessories would be appreciated too. Just want your opinions. Thanks!

About the Wiimote, get Nintendo wiimotes. 3rd part wiimotes are prone to have issues with Dolphin...
